This collection features fractals from all three Galleries (General Use, Cross Stitch Patterns, and Posters).  This figure is still being revised.   Below are the number of fractals in my collection that are 3D ChromaDepth ready.  What does 3D ready mean?  Simply that there are fractals that appear to float off the screen, there are fractals that appear to sink into the screen, some may have significant portions that float and/or sink, or there may be elements that have 3D qualities when looked at with the ChromaDepth glasses are worn.  The background fractal for this page is an example image.  Sometimes you can look at a 3D ready fractal and not exactly see the "painted glass" look where different layers of the fractal image look as though they were painted on glass and then layered one atop the other.  Yet at the same time there is something just quirky enough about the image that it looks cooler with the glasses on than it does when you aren't wearing them.

The beauty of 3D ChromaDepth glasses is they work for print images, images on a computer screen, images on a TV screen (standard or high definition), and even work with projectors.  Try watching a color rich movie such as Speed Racer and you'll essentially turned your "2D" set into a "3D" set just by wearing a pair of ChromaDepth (or Crayola 3D) glasses.  Please be mindful to blink because when you first start wearing these glasses things will be so cool you may forget to blink.  Just close your eyes for ten or more seconds (or remove the glasses for the same period of time) to give your eyes a break.  When you put the glasses back on it is like your eyes are recharged and things look even better.  Experiment with room lighting to get the best results.  Darker rooms or less glaring lights seem to work better.  At least that is how it is for me.

What are the above Trippy Themed links all about?  When Gaylaxicon came to Atlanta in 2007 I was contacted to create two unique Video Art styles for their convention.  They had a live band performing cover music of The B-52s and a dance afterward.  For both a LCD projector was used to create a fractal light show.  With their criteria in mind I scoured my fractals and came up with 12,039 matches about a day or two later.  That is how this sub-category got its start.  All of these were found from within General Use volumes 1 - 13, Plasma Clouds, and Plasma Fractals.  What are Plasma Fractals?  They are the combination of plasma cloud backgrounds with fractal foregrounds.  Whether you are sober or not these gems are sure to please.
